Deskripsi:
1. Pencacahan, 2. Fungsi Pembangkit, 3. Relasi Rekurensi, 4. Prinsip Inklusi-Eksklusi
Capaian Pembelajaran
- Mampu menjelaskan secara kritis terkait konsep pencacahan, aturan jumlah dan aturan kali, fungsi pembangkit biasa dan fungsi pembangkit eksponensial, relasi rekurensi, dan prinsip inklusi-ekslusi.
- Mampu menyelesaikan masalah secara kreatif terkait model pencacahan, persamaan dengan domain dan kodomain bilangan bulat, fungsi pembangkit, relasi rekurensi, dan prinsip inklusi-ekslusi.
